The North European Basin hosts mineral deposits like the Kupferschiefer and the Mississippi Valley Type deposits in the Silesian sub‐basin in Poland. The basement to this basin, exposed in the Harz Mts and in the Flechtingen and Calvörde Blocks, contains Mesozoic Pb–Zn vein mineralization and barite–fluorite deposits as well as massive hematite veins in the Rotliegend volcanics. A comparison of the mineralizing models of these deposits with results from a basin‐wide petrographic, fluid inclusion and stable isotope study shows that the genesis of the mineral deposits can be explained by fluid systems that were active during different stages of basin evolution. These comprise syn‐ to post‐magmatic fluids derived from or mobilized in the course of the Rotliegend magmatism, fluids convecting in the Rotliegend units during the extensional basin subsidence in the Permo‐Triassic and originating from progressive devolatilization of the basin sequence and fluids derived from the overlying Zechstein evaporites. Deep‐reaching fault systems developing during the Cretaceous tectonic reactivation enhanced fluid percolation from the surface to the deep sections of the basin sequence. Identification and correlation of these fluids across the basin and in the mineralizations provide the base for a basin‐wide metallogenetic model.  相似文献

The commodification of pottery cannot be reduced to strict econo-technological terms. Commodification is a cultural process, enmeshed in local, regional, and international systems of meaning. As Victorian Modernism eroded, anti-modern movements commodified traditional culture. These philosophies, themselves commodities, had repercussions on the pottery industry throughout the world. In both America and Australia, these processes produced art and studio potteries. In the American Great Basin, these changes were experienced very differently by potters from different cultures. The commodification and industrialization of modern pottery factories predicated the reification of a pre-industrial artisanal past.  相似文献

There is a great contrast in geochemical and hydrogeologic estimates of the residence times of pore fluids in sedimentary basins. This contrast is particularly evident in the Alberta Basin, Canada, which has served as the study area for important studies of long‐term fluid flow and transport. To address these differences, we developed two‐dimensional simulations of groundwater age, constrained by both hydrogeologic and geochemical observations, to estimate the residence time of fluids and the amount and timing of flushing by meteoric waters in the Alberta Basin. Results suggest that old, residual brines have been retained in the deepest parts of the basin since their formation ca. 400 Ma, but significant dilution by younger waters has reduced the age of these pore waters to no more than approximately 200 My. Shallower formations have been flushed extensively by fresh, young waters. Loss of brines and dilution of older pore waters occurred primarily after the uplift of the Rockies with the introduction of the gravity‐driven flow regime. Despite these large changes in flow regime, solute exchange between deep saline aquifers and the overlying vigorous freshwater flow system was found to be consistent with long‐term dispersive mixing across subhorizontal concentration gradients rather than by direct flushing. Sensitivity studies using an analytic solution supported the use of 100 m for transverse dispersivity in large‐scale numerical models. These simulations confirm that the age and origin of brines are in many cases poor indicators of long‐term solute transport rates in sedimentary basins, but the geochemical indicators that are used to determine the origin of brines can provide useful constraints for calculating groundwater age and are far more commonly available than isotopic groundwater age tracers.  相似文献

尼罗河流域文明与地理环境变迁研究   总被引:1,自引:1,他引:0  
王会昌 《人文地理》1996,11(1):12-16
本文根据对尼罗河流域文明区地理环境变迁研究的结果,认为正是由于距今9000-4000年前亚非季风势力增强、季风雨量增加给尼罗河流域带来的湿润气候,为文明的形成和初步发展创造了优越的地理环境。因而尼罗河流域文明不仅仅是"尼罗河的赠礼",而应当更准确地说它是"季风雨的赠礼"。也正是由于季风雨的多寡在很大程度上制约着文明的盛衰,因此,由于从距今4000年前后开始的季风势力衰退和季风雨量锐减而导致的干旱化、沙漠化,则逐步吞噬了这一古老的文明。  相似文献

柴达木盆地自然生态环境十分脆弱,这种状况不但由其禀赋所决定,更与近50多年来人类在盆地开展的大规模生产活动不无关系。该时段的大部分时间,盆地内人与自然的关系基本上是对立的,从而在很大程度上导致了其自然生态环境更加脆弱并向恶化的方向持续变迁,已经严重威胁到该区域人类正常的生产生活。因此,在统筹柴达木盆地各种关系、构建和谐社会时,要更加重视其人与自然关系的和谐,以确保我国生态安全和资源安全。  相似文献

Mortoniceratid ammonites of the Eromanga Basin of Queensland, although uncommon, are reviewed and reassessed utilising all known collections. Representatives of this group are restricted to the Allaru Formation and almost all specimens are Goodhallites goodhalli, a well-known species from the English Gault. The Allaru Formation overlies the Toolebuc Formation, widely considered to be an essentially isochronous unit because of its unusual sedimentary and geochemical character. Using G. goodhalli, the middle and upper Allaru Formation can be directly correlated with the early late Albian orbignyi and auritus Subzones of the Mortoniceras inflatum Zone as recognized in the reference ammonite zonation embedded in the standard Cretaceous time scale. Overlapping ranges of G. goodhalli and Labeceras and Myloceras allow these common Austral heteromorph genera to be also confidently assigned a late Albian age in Australia, matching their biostratigraphic occurrence in South Africa.  相似文献

Archaeology has always faced the problem of making informed inferences based on an incomplete record. Zooarchaeological studies of prehistoric hunting and diet offer a clear case in point, where a range of behavioral and taphonomic factors can produce a substantial disconnect between what people actually captured and ate and what archaeologists recover and interpret. We explore this disconnect by presenting stable C and N data for wild faunas, archaeological maize, and three human burials from Fremont-period sites in southeastern Utah, the United States. We use these data to estimate faunal contributions to prehistoric diets and compare the results with previous zooarchaeological analyses of faunas from the same sites. Results for the two approaches differ sharply, with isotopic estimates showing much higher contributions of small and lowland game. We discuss these results in terms of both local prehistory and wider issues of taphonomy and dietary analysis.  相似文献

A new genus and species, Emwadea microcarpa Dettmann, Clifford & Peters, is established for ovulate/seed cones with helically arranged cone scales bearing a centrally positioned, inverted ovule from the basal Winton Formation (late Albian), Eromanga Basin, Queensland. The cones are small, prolate ellipsoidal (9.5–14 mm vertical axis, 6.3–8.7 mm transverse axis) with wedge-shaped cone scales bearing winged seeds attached adaxially to the scale only by tissues surrounding the vasculature entering the ovule. Ovuliferous tissue that is free from the cone scale extends distally from the chalaza; the seeds' lateral wings are derived from the integument. Foliage attached to the cones is spirally arranged, imbricate and with spreading and incurved bifacial blades with acute tips; stomata are arranged in longitudinal files and are confined to the adaxial surface. The cone organization testifies to placement within the Araucariaceae, and is morphologically more similar to Wollemia and Agathis than to Araucaria.

The design of a projectile delivery system often plays a critical role in the durability and breakage patterns associated with spent projectile points. This paper presents the results of an experimental project designed to examine projectile point durability and breakage patterns between three different hafting methods. Specifically, we compare two asphaltum hafting techniques drawn from archaeological and ethnohistoric accounts from the Central Valley of California with a more stereotypical cross-hatched sinew hafting system. Our results suggest a small yet statistically significant increase in durability among asphaltum hafted points, opening the door to future research on these ethnohistorically documented hafting techniques.  相似文献

A new genus and species of campterophlebiid damsel-dragonfly, Jurassophlebia xinjiangensis gen. et sp. nov., is described from the Lower Jurassic Badaowan Formation in the Junggar Basin, northwestern China. Jurassophlebia differs from all other campterophlebiid genera in having PsA in the same orientation as the distal branch of AA, and in its uniquely open subdiscoidal cell with very acute apical angle in the hind wing. The new discovery adds to the Asian diversity of damsel-dragonflies in the earliest Jurassic.
